Output 84ca820924a0a42c82cb66590b1d3b5af3f54629b4eb2e260ba7640c9f3dc73c:2

value
151368271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6924ed7ad8408d9c5ef436d64cbb333ca7d08f6b OP_EQUAL
address
3BGy7Ttf1MnrdTeS8N9cm6M7epxYtxJLBK
transaction
84ca820924a0a42c82cb66590b1d3b5af3f54629b4eb2e260ba7640c9f3dc73c
spent
true